Firstly, the name is made up of two different terms that are unlikely to be used in this world or in any international arena. Ju-jutsu is a compound word, on the one hand, “ju” means a curse, and “jutsu” means a technique or ability.
Internationally, jiu-jitsu means sorcery, something closely tied to history. However, it has also been interpreted as the idea of manipulating the enemy’s forces against himself.
The term “Kaisen” seems to give a little more meaning to the title of Akutami-sensei’s work, since “Kai” means “eternity” or “repetition”, just like “Sen” means battle or war. Put together, it all refers to the eternal battle.
